TANGLEWOOD Release Date is 14th August 2018

According to their latest Kickstarter update, they wanted to ship the cartridges prior to the digital release on Steam, but had a hiccup along the way. They’re still trying to match the dates but it may not be feasible. Worst come to worst, backers of the physical edition also had the Digital format in their reward pack, so they will be able to play it that way if they can’t wait.

Wow - this is the work of one dude?